Anamorphic gradient index (GRIN) lens for beam shaping

In this short communication we are reporting a new kind of rod lens with toric power with moderately large power difference. These rods can be directly used in coupling power from a semiconductor laser to optical fiber or in free space communication to convert the beam shape. This rod may directly be butt-jointed to the laser, which may attract many application scientists. Moreover, anamorphic power in a GRIN lens can be generated by proper selection of geometry of the substrate for ion exchange. This may lead to a new kind of optical system that needs further exploration.
